There are a number of apps that are pretty good.  The apps I have tried are onX and Gaia, and both do the job.  Any app you get should be able to operate without an cell/internet connection.  Every app I've looked at adds functionality when you pay for the non-free version.  That said,  I've always been partial to paper maps (USGS 1:24,000), a decent land navigation compass, and/or a GPS unit.  I've worked in the remote field for a long time, and have preferences formed by the experience.
